How much does well pump repair cost in Wakulla County?

Expect well pump repair in Wakulla County to run roughly $200–$2,500 for typical residential work. Final pricing depends on system size, site access, soil conditions, and how much the job actually involves once a crew is on site. Older properties, hard-to-reach tanks, and added permitting can push costs toward the higher end of that range, while straightforward jobs land near the bottom. How to choose a Wakulla County provider

Confirm the contractor holds an active Florida license, ask for references on similar well pump repair jobs nearby, and get the full scope and price in writing before work starts. Local experience matters more than most homeowners expect: a provider who regularly works in Wakulla County understands the area's soils, terrain, and permitting quirks, which keeps your project on schedule and code-compliant. Avoid quotes that seem far below the others — unusually cheap bids often skip permitting or cut corners that cost far more to fix later. About Wakulla County

North Florida Gulf Coast county south of Tallahassee with flat terrain, sandy soils, and the world-famous Wakulla Springs, one of the largest and deepest freshwater springs. The unconfined Floridan Aquifer is extremely vulnerable, and septic systems are a documented contributor to declining spring water quality and increasing nitrate levels. Wells are shallow into the Floridan Aquifer with hard water, and the county is a focal point for advanced OSTDS requirements to protect springs.
